Quality Summary
---------------------------------------
QA Conclusion: Not Recommend for Crosswalk Lite public release.

WRT and Embedding API Use cases Testing are totally blocked by one major 
regression: fail to pack crosswalk lite test 
suites(XWALK-4279<https://crosswalk-project.org/jira/browse/XWALK-4279>), 
feature verification of interface for initializing XWalkView 
asynchronously(XWLK-3971<https://crosswalk-project.org/jira/browse/XWALK-3971>) 
is blocked on crosswalk lite as well. Four additional Crosswalk Lite specific 
regression issues found:[REG]fail to get location 
information(XWALK-4280<https://crosswalk-project.org/jira/browse/XWALK-4280>), 
[REG]No response after clicking buttons of 
Presentation(XWALK-4281<https://crosswalk-project.org/jira/browse/XWALK-4281>), 
[REG]Fail to get navigator.system or xwalk.experimental.system 
property(XWALK-4282<https://crosswalk-project.org/jira/browse/XWALK-4282>), 
[REG]navigator.getUserMedia got 
undefined(XWALK-4283<https://crosswalk-project.org/jira/browse/XWALK-4283>). 
Feature for LZMA support 
backport(XWALK-3810<https://crosswalk-project.org/jira/browse/XWALK-3810>) 
works fine on Crosswalk lite. The overall test results:
Test Scope

Total TCs

Run rate

Pass Rate

Pass Rate of Executed

Diff W/
Lite 10.39.232.1

Diff W/
15.43.347.0(canary)

Comment

Use Cases

148

41%

32%

78%

-23%

-56%

Most tests are blocked by 
XWALK-4279<https://crosswalk-project.org/jira/browse/XWALK-4279>

Total

148

41%

32%

78%

-23%

-56%


New Issues:

-          XWALK-4279<https://crosswalk-project.org/jira/browse/XWALK-4279> P1 
[REG][usecase]Failed to pack Crosswalk lite usecase suites by using make.py.

-          XWALK-4280<https://crosswalk-project.org/jira/browse/XWALK-4280> P2 
[REG]Fail to get location informaiton of latitude and longitude position on 
android

-          XWALK-4281<https://crosswalk-project.org/jira/browse/XWALK-4281> P2 
[REG]No response after clicking 'Request Show Presentation' button of webapi 
usecase/Presentation

-          XWALK-4282<https://crosswalk-project.org/jira/browse/XWALK-4282> P2 
[REG]Fail to get navigator.system or xwalk.experimental.system property

-          XWALK-4283<https://crosswalk-project.org/jira/browse/XWALK-4283> P2 
[REG]navigator.getUserMedia got undefined when running webapi 
usecase/CameraviaUserMedia

User Experience Evaluation Table
User experience check points

App Source

Test Result

Diff W/
Lite 10.39.232.1

Smooth Installation Process

http://html5test.com/

LZMA compression: compress 9.8M

--

Progress bar UI: works fine

--

Decompression time: 11 seconds

--

HTML5 Support

http://html5test.com/

Crosswalk Mini: 464

--

Crosswalk: 494

--

First Launch Time Comparison

Crosswalk: Hangonman

Crosswalk: 2 seconds

--

Crosswalk Mini: Hangonman

Crosswalk Mini: 11 seconds

--

Native App: WeChat

Native App: 1 second

--

App Screen Rotation

https://crosswalk-project.org/

The Rotation function works well, both for Apps with English and Chinese 
language.

--

m.ctrip.com (in Chinese)

m.mogujie.com (in Chinese)

Frame Rate

http://ie.microsoft.com/testdrive/performance/fishietank/

58 FPS/100 fish: 48 FPS

--





Crosswalk Lite Use Cases Testing Details
Component

Total TCs

Android IA

Diff W/
Lite 10.39.232.1

Diff W/
15.43.347.0(canary)

Comments

WRT

48

0%

-86%

-90%

Blocked by XWALK-4279<https://crosswalk-project.org/jira/browse/XWALK-4279> 
[REG][usecase]Failed to pack Crosswalk lite usecase suites by using make.py.

W3C API

60

□□□□□□□78%

+49%

-11%

XWALK-2660<https://crosswalk-project.org/jira/browse/XWALK-2660> [REG]It is not 
available for label type="file" which load resource file failed on Android OS
XWALK-2663<https://crosswalk-project.org/jira/browse/XWALK-2663> flex-flow and 
justify-content attribute in flexbox can not completely finished rendering 
effect when running the "flexibleBox" component
XWALK-837<https://crosswalk-project.org/jira/browse/XWALK-837> Security Error 
occurs when calling requestFilesystem method on Android OS
XWALK-2666<https://crosswalk-project.org/jira/browse/XWALK-2666> Fail to get 
correct type of devicemotion.acceleration.x/y/z and 
devicemotion.rotationRate.alpha when running the "W3C/Deviceorientation" on 
some devices
XWALK-1693<https://crosswalk-project.org/jira/browse/XWALK-1693> Fail to get 
correct value of “connection status” when running “Use Case/BrowserState” on 
Android OS
XWALK-1457<https://crosswalk-project.org/jira/browse/XWALK-1457> No selection 
list displayed in the input when running “Use Case/Input” on Android OS
Diff with Crosswalk Lite 10.39.232.1, Got improvement due to 
XWALK-3465<https://crosswalk-project.org/jira/browse/XWALK-3465> is not 
reproduced
Diff with Crosswalk canary15.43.347.0,Got downgrade due to four new regression 
issues reported:
XWALK-4280<https://crosswalk-project.org/jira/browse/XWALK-4280> [REG]Fail to 
get location informaiton of latitude and longitude position on android
XWALK-4281<https://crosswalk-project.org/jira/browse/XWALK-4281> [REG]No 
response after clicking 'Request Show Presentation' button of webapi 
usecase/Presentation
XWALK-4282<https://crosswalk-project.org/jira/browse/XWALK-4282> [REG]Fail to 
get navigator.system or xwalk.experimental.system property
XWALK-4283<https://crosswalk-project.org/jira/browse/XWALK-4283> 
[REG]navigator.getUserMedia got undefined when running webapi 
usecase/CameraviaUserMedia

Embedding API

20

0%

-93%

-85%

Blocked by XWALK-4279<https://crosswalk-project.org/jira/browse/XWALK-4279> 
[REG][usecase]Failed to pack Crosswalk lite usecase suites by using make.py.

Embedding API Async

20

0%

-93%

-85%

Blocked by XWALK-4279<https://crosswalk-project.org/jira/browse/XWALK-4279> 
[REG][usecase]Failed to pack Crosswalk lite usecase suites by using make.py.




Verify Issues:
-----------------------
N/A

Crosswalk Lite build for Android:
https://download.01.org/crosswalk/releases/crosswalk-lite/android/canary/10.39.235.1/

Github Test Suite Links:
https://github.com/crosswalk-project/crosswalk-test-suite/

Operating System:
Android Image version: 4.2.2/4.4.4
Test Environment
-----------------------

l   Crosswalk Android:

o   IA phone: ZTE V975

o   IA Tablet (Baytrail T): Asus Memo Pad8

Thanks
Crosswalk QA
_______________________________________________
Crosswalk-dev mailing list
[email protected]
https://lists.crosswalk-project.org/mailman/listinfo/crosswalk-dev

Reply via email to